Ten Krooni 2010 Vancouver Olympics, Coin from Estonia (demonetised 2011)
CoinTen Krooni 2010 Vancouver Olympics

The second Estonian kroon currency was introduced in 1992, after Estonia gained independence from the USSR. The kroon was subdivided into 100 cents (senti; singular sent). The 10 krooni denomination was served by a banknote for circulation. Ten krooni coins were only issued as non-circulating commemoratives only (also known as Non-Circulating Legal Tender - NCLT); they were made of silver.

The coins were legal tender until 15 January 2011 when they were demonetised and replaced with the Euro, when Estonia joined the Euro currency.

This coin was issued in celebration of the XXI Winter Olympic Games in Vancouver, 2010.

It was struck in fine silver (99.9%) in Proof FDC grade only.

No coins of this type were issued into circulation.

Obverse
Estonia / Ten Krooni 2010 Vancouver Olympics - obverse photo

The obverse design depicts, within a rim, an ornate Coat of Arms of Estonia, consisting of three lions passant gardant (walking to left, facing the observer) on a shield with a mirror-like surface, the shield on a wreath of oak leaves. The date 2010 is below the wreath.

Around above, EESTI VABARIIK (Republic of Estonia).

Obverse Inscription EESTI VABARIIK 2010
Reverse
Estonia / Ten Krooni 2010 Vancouver Olympics - reverse photo

The reverse depicts a dynamic stylised image of racing cross-country skiers. Above them, the logo of the Estonian Olympic Committee consisting of an Olympic flame over the interlocking Olympic rings.

Around above left, the value and denomination 10 KROONI. Around below right, XXI.

Reverse Inscription 10 KROONI XXI

Notes

Note that Eesti Pank phrases the mintage figure as "maximum mintage", implying that not all coins of the 10,000 limit were actually struck.
